1. Zero-Inbox Automation
Stop reading every email. In 2026, we use “Semantic Filters.”
• What to do: Set up an AI agent that scans your emails not just for keywords, but for intent.
• The Result: The AI drafts responses for routine inquiries and only alerts you for high-priority human decisions.
2. Meeting-Free Workflows
Meetings are the biggest time-thieves. AI has fixed this.
• What to do: Use a “Shadow Attendee” AI tool. Send your AI agent to the meeting in your place. It will record, summarize, and—most importantly—extract the specific action items assigned to you.
• The Result: You spend 0 minutes in meetings and get 100% of the information.
3. The “Deep Work” Shield
AI can now predict when you are most productive and block all distractions.
• What to do: Connect your AI productivity coach to your calendar and computer usage data. It will automatically disable notifications and “ghost” your messages when it detects you are in a flow state.
4. Automated Content Repurposing
If you are a creator or a business owner, stop making content for 5 different platforms.
• What to do: Create one “Core” piece of content (like a video or an article). Use an AI workflow to automatically split it into 10 Tweets, 5 LinkedIn posts, and 3 Instagram Reels.
• The Result: You post everywhere, but you only work once.
